Opening for WASTE 2 ART 2022 Exhibition and Competition - The Year of Soft Plastics

By Lithgow City Council
Archived 3 Jul 2022 - Posted: 4 May 2022
All the creative work is finished, the judging completed and now it’s time to announce the winners. It’s been a competition that has captured everyone’s imagination! Come along to Eskbank House Museum and see for yourself.

The Sims Metal WASTE 2 ART Competition 2022, supported by Sims Metal and the NSW EPA, represents a creative and innovative approach to the reduction and reuse of waste in the Central West.

The exhibition opening and announcement of Lithgow winners will be at Eskbank House Museum on Sunday 8 May 2022 at 10.30am for an 11am start. This is a FREE event but numbers are limited. Bookings can be made on Eventbrite and by following this link here

The Public Exhibition runs from 8 May through to 29 May 2022 during museum open hours, Wednesday to Sunday 10am-4pm.
